Quick Color Tap!
A simple but very challenging game! You see a screen with 16 colored squares (4 colors of red, blue, green and yellow) and by tapping once on the screen, the game will start. As soon as the game starts, the background color will blink very quickly with one of those 4 colors and you have to choose a square with the same color to remove it. If you choose a square with a different color, you will lose.
How to Play Quick Color Tap!?
Touch on mobile device or mouse on PC.
